Setting Up a New Toilet Flange:



  • Picking the Right Replacement Flange


  • When installing a new commode flange, the primary step is to select the ideal substitute for your plumbing setup. Think about variables such as the material of the flange, with alternatives including PVC, ABS, or cast iron. PVC flanges are understood for their affordability and resistance to corrosion, making them a prominent choice for DIY fanatics. Abdominal flanges supply similar advantages to PVC but boast included durability, making them appropriate for high-traffic locations or commercial settings. Cast iron flanges, renowned for their toughness and longevity, are optimal for installations where toughness is extremely important. In addition, make sure that the replacement flange is correctly sized and fits snugly right into location to create a leak-proof seal and avoid leaks.

    Protecting the Flange to the Floor:



    As soon as you've chosen the ideal substitute flange, it's important to safeguard it effectively to the floor to ensure security and protect against future issues. Begin by placing and aligning the flange appropriately over the drain, making sure that it sits flush with the flooring surface area. Depending upon the kind of flange and your details installment preferences, you can protect the flange to the flooring utilizing screws or glue. If using screws, make certain to use corrosion-resistant options to prevent rusting in time. Alternatively, adhesive can give a protected bond between the flange and the floor, guaranteeing a strong and reputable setup. By following these actions and taking the essential precautions, you can install a brand-new toilet flange with self-confidence, making certain a resilient and leak-free plumbing component.

    Sorts Of Toilet Flanges:



    Recognizing the different sorts of toilet flanges is vital for selecting one of the most suitable choice for your plumbing requires. PVC, ABS, and cast iron are among the typical products utilized in commode flange building and construction, each offering distinctive benefits and factors to consider. PVC flanges, understood for their price and deterioration resistance, are favoured for their convenience of setup and toughness. Abdominal flanges, similar to PVC in terms of price and simplicity of installation, are treasured for their effectiveness and resistance to impacts. On the other hand, cast iron flanges, renowned for their exceptional strength and durability, are frequently liked for high-traffic locations or business settings where toughness is extremely important. By familiarising on your own with the features of each material, you can make a notified choice when selecting a bathroom flange that aligns with your particular demands and preferences.

    In addition to material considerations, toilet flanges additionally come in numerous design and styles to accommodate different plumbing arrangements and installation preferences. Offset flanges, for instance, are made to fit bathrooms mounted on floorings that are uneven or where the waste pipe lies off-centre. Similarly, repair flanges, likewise known as repair work rings or spacer rings, are used to resolve problems such as fractured or broken flanges without the requirement for considerable plumbing adjustments. Furthermore, flexible flanges use versatility ready, permitting accurate positioning and fit during installation. By checking out the varied range of commode flange types and designs offered, you can choose the option that best matches your plumbing configuration and setup requirements, making sure a seamless and trustworthy solution for your washroom components.

    TOILET REPAIR HOW TO REPLACE A BROKEN TOILET FLANGE


    First remove the toilet. Turn off the water line, flush the toilet, and remove the water line from the bottom of the toilet tank. Have bucket handy, as water will come out of the tank. Sponge out as much water from the tank and bowl as you can. A handyman trick is to use a wet dry shop vac to suck all the water out of the bowl and tank.


    Remove the nuts on each side of the base of the toilet. These nuts-bolts attach the toilet to the flange. You may have to use a saw to cut the nuts off, which is ok, because you are going to put in new toilet bolts and nuts. The flange, when brand new, is attached to the waste pipe. Many times it rusts or snaps off. Tilt the toilet on its side and move out of the way. Have a helper assist you in moving the toilet, they are heavy and bulky.


    Use a putty knife to remove the wax ring residue from the exposed flange and inspect the flange and surrounding area. What is key here is if the wood subfloor is rotted. If this is the case, you will have to cut out the surrounding subfloor and replace it with new plywood, then fix the flange.



    Thankfully on this home improvement project, the subfloor was fine, just the flange fell apart. Go to your hardware store and buy a Super Ring Replacement Toilet Ring. There are several models by different suppliers, don't buy the cheapest one, its your toilet, remember...



    Also at the hardware store buy new toilet mounting bolts, they usually come in a package with the nuts and washers.


    Put the toilet mounting bolts in the flange pointing up, and use some wax from the old wax ring to hold them in place. Place the super ring replacement toilet ring over the waste line, making sure the mounting bolts are in the same place as the original bolts were, one bolt on each side of the flange.



    Screw the new flange into the subfloor. You may have to use a hammer drill to drill through existing tile flooring or cement substrate. Set the new toilet wax ring onto the flange on the base of the toilet, and guide the toilet back onto the super ring, making sure the toilet mounting bolts are lined up with the mount holes in the toilet base. The super ring toilet ring allows for you to adjust the location of the bolts.
